for the front turn signal it can be superwhite, that's legal, but you need to have an amber reflector somewhere. so on the GS, the turn signal could be white no problem but you need to keep the amber reflector on the bumper to stay legal.

for the rear, you don't need to have any amber reflector but at least you need to have either an amber or red bulb

that's the rule for cali
